On the General Settings page, select the NSX-T workload domain where you want to deploy the Enterprise PKS solution and provide the authentication settings for the management components.

Procedure

  1. On the SDDC Manager Dashboard, select Workload Domains from the navigation panel.
  2. In the PKS section, click Get Started.
  3. Select the checboxes to ensure that all required prerequisites have been ment and then click Begin.
  4. Select the license agreements and click Next.
  5. On the General Settings page, type a name for the Enterprise PKS solution.

  6. Select the NSX-T workload domain where you want to deploy Enterprise PKS.
  7. Type a password for the Administrator user.

    The password must contain nine or more characters and can be a mix of uppercase and lowercase characters, numbers, and special characters`

  8. Re-type the Administrator password.
  9. In the PKS Master section, type a user name for the Enterprise PKS API account.
    The Enterprise PKS API account is used for performing cluster operations.
  10. Type a password for the Enterprise PKS API account.

    The password must contain nine or more characters and can be a mix of uppercase and lowercase characters, numbers, and special characters`

  11. Re-type the password for the Enterprise PKS API account.
  12. Enter a decryption password.

    The decryption passphrase is used to encrypt the Operations Manager system. You must store this value securely as it needs to be entered after each Operations Manager reboot. The passphrase cannot be retrieved or reset.

    The password must contain nine or more characters and can be a mix of uppercase and lowercase characters, numbers, and special characters.

  13. Re-type the decryption password.
  14. Click Next.
